use dd to copy a disk


Ok, I have a floppy that has a license key on it for a windoze program. The floppy that it is stored on cannot be seen under windows. XP complains that its not formatted. Under Ubuntu I can mount it and see it no problem.

So I want to copy the disk, including the VSN which the license is tied to. Any recommendations.

Code:
dd if=/dev/fd0 of=filename.img
copies the floppy exactly byte-by-byte. The problem is, the license key floppy might have some form of protection against dd.
